Martina Hessel
1930-2020
On Mother’s Day May 10, 2020 Martina
Muilwijk Hessel, loving wife and mother of three children passed away
at the age of 90.
Martina was born on February
7, 1930 in Rotterdam Netherlands to Arie Muilwijk and
Neeltje-Ober-Muilwijk. She grew up in Utrecht where
She met the love of her life, Johannes, shortly after WWII, they
married and immigrated to Montreal with their son Ron in 1953, where
their daughters Ingrid and Angela were born.
Together
they all moved to Ford Bank in 1974. In 1991 Martina sadly lost her
husband of thirty-nine years. She remained in Ford Bank
until 2001, when she moved to Church Court in
Moncton.
Martina was a dedicated and
devoted mother first and foremost. She treasured her children and
embraced every moment with them.
She was
a sharp open minded and forgiving person with a strong understanding
of human nature and could always see the other side of any
situation. She taught us all to be more
compassionate. Always a
generous soul, she loved to spoil her
children, grandchildren and great grandchildren, never forgetting a
birthday or special occasion.
As a young woman she worked in
retail. Later in life she trained and worked as a cook in
Moncton and then the Cook Nook in Richibucto. She also served as the
personal chef of JD Irving for a short time.
Faced
with many challenges in her life she always dealt with things head on
and did her best to make the most of every
situation. Surviving WWII, she had many
stories to share, none as sweet as the day Canada liberated Holland.
She was 15 at the time.
